Tuesday, 10 December 2024

Machine Learning: A Transformative Technology

In recent years, Machine Learning (ML) has emerged as one of the most influential and transformative fields in technology. From voice assistants like Siri and Alexa to recommendation engines on platforms like Netflix and Amazon, machine learning is already deeply integrated into our daily lives. But what exactly is machine learning, and why is it such a buzzword in the tech world?

In this blog, we will break down the fundamentals of machine learning, its applications, and its significance in shaping industries and innovations of the future.


What is Machine Learning?

Machine Learning is a subset of Artificial Intelligence (AI) that enables machines to learn from data and make decisions without being explicitly programmed. Instead of following a set of predefined rules, machine learning systems identify patterns and insights from data, improving their performance over time as they are exposed to more information.

At its core, machine learning allows computers to:

  • Identify patterns in large datasets.
  • Make predictions or decisions based on those patterns.
  • Improve their performance autonomously as they process more data.

How Does Machine Learning Work?

Machine learning algorithms work by using data to train a model, which can then be used to make predictions or decisions. The process can be broken down into three main phases:

1. Data Collection and Preprocessing

  • Raw data (such as text, images, or numerical values) is collected from various sources. This data often needs cleaning, transforming, and normalizing to ensure it's in a usable form for training the model.

2. Training the Model

  • The preprocessed data is fed into a machine learning algorithm, which builds a mathematical model that can recognize patterns or relationships in the data.

3. Making Predictions

  • Once the model is trained, it can be used to make predictions on new, unseen data. Over time, the model can improve its accuracy through continuous learning.

Types of Machine Learning

Machine learning is a broad field with various approaches. The three main types of machine learning are:

1. Supervised Learning

  • What It Is: In supervised learning, the algorithm is trained on labeled data, meaning each training data point is paired with the correct output or label. The model learns to predict the output from the input.
  • Applications: Email spam detection, image classification, and medical diagnosis.
  • Example: Training a model to recognize whether an email is spam or not, using a dataset of emails labeled as "spam" or "not spam."

2. Unsupervised Learning

  • What It Is: In unsupervised learning, the algorithm is given unlabeled data and must find hidden patterns or intrinsic structures within the data on its own.
  • Applications: Customer segmentation, anomaly detection, and market basket analysis.
  • Example: Grouping customers based on purchasing behavior without pre-defined categories.

3. Reinforcement Learning

  • What It Is: Reinforcement learning involves training an agent to make a sequence of decisions by rewarding it for good actions and penalizing it for bad ones. The agent learns to maximize its cumulative reward over time.
  • Applications: Robotics, game-playing AI (like AlphaGo), and autonomous vehicles.
  • Example: Training a robot to navigate an environment by rewarding it for reaching the goal and penalizing it for hitting obstacles.



Key Algorithms in Machine Learning

Machine learning encompasses a wide range of algorithms. Some of the most commonly used ones include:

1. Linear Regression

  • A statistical method used for predicting a continuous output based on one or more input features.
  • Example: Predicting house prices based on features like size, location, and number of rooms.

2. Decision Trees

  • A model that splits data into branches based on feature values, creating a tree-like structure that helps make decisions.
  • Example: Classifying whether an individual qualifies for a loan based on age, income, and credit score.

3. Support Vector Machines (SVM)

  • An algorithm that finds the optimal hyperplane to separate data points into different classes.
  • Example: Image classification tasks, such as distinguishing between cats and dogs in photos.

4. Neural Networks

  • Modeled after the human brain, neural networks are composed of layers of interconnected nodes (neurons) that learn to recognize patterns by adjusting the weights of connections.
  • Example: Image recognition, speech recognition, and natural language processing (NLP).

5. k-Nearest Neighbors (k-NN)

  • A simple algorithm that classifies a data point based on the majority class of its nearest neighbors in the feature space.
  • Example: Classifying diseases based on patient features such as symptoms and medical history.


Applications of Machine Learning

Machine learning has a vast range of applications across various industries. Here are some notable examples:

1. Healthcare

  • Machine learning models help in diagnosing diseases, predicting patient outcomes, and personalizing treatment plans.
  • Example: AI-powered systems that can analyze medical images like X-rays and MRIs to detect conditions like tumors or fractures.

2. Finance

  • ML is used for fraud detection, credit scoring, algorithmic trading, and risk management.
  • Example: Detecting unusual patterns in financial transactions to identify fraudulent activity.

3. Retail and E-commerce

  • Recommendation engines, inventory management, and demand forecasting all rely on machine learning to enhance customer experiences and optimize business operations.
  • Example: Personalized product recommendations based on a customer's browsing and purchasing history.

4. Autonomous Vehicles

  • Self-driving cars use machine learning algorithms to process data from sensors, cameras, and radars to navigate the road and make driving decisions.
  • Example: Tesla’s Autopilot system uses ML to detect objects, predict traffic patterns, and navigate safely.

5. Natural Language Processing (NLP)

  • Machine learning is a core component of NLP, which enables machines to understand, interpret, and generate human language.
  • Example: Chatbots, virtual assistants like Siri or Google Assistant, and automatic translation services.

The Future of Machine Learning

The future of machine learning is incredibly promising, with continuous advancements being made in the field. Here are a few trends to watch out for:

1. Deep Learning

  • As a subset of machine learning, deep learning (which uses neural networks with many layers) is expected to continue revolutionizing fields like computer vision, NLP, and robotics.

2. Explainable AI (XAI)

  • As ML models become more complex, there is a growing focus on making them more transparent and interpretable to humans, which is crucial for applications in healthcare, finance, and law.

3. Ethical AI

  • With the rise of machine learning, ethical considerations regarding bias, fairness, and accountability are becoming increasingly important. Researchers are working to build models that are more ethical and free of bias.


4. Integration with Internet of Things (IoT)

  • Machine learning will play a key role in analyzing and processing the vast amounts of data generated by IoT devices, leading to smarter homes, cities, and industrial systems.

Conclusion

Machine learning is no longer just a theoretical concept; it’s an integral part of modern technology. With applications across virtually every industry, machine learning is reshaping how businesses operate, how we interact with technology, and even how we live our lives. By understanding its fundamentals, algorithms, and real-world applications, we can better appreciate the transformative power of machine learning and its role in the future.

As machine learning continues to evolve, it holds immense potential for solving complex problems, improving efficiencies, and creating innovative solutions that could change the world in ways we’ve never imagined. So whether you’re a tech enthusiast or a professional looking to integrate ML into your work, now is the perfect time to dive into this exciting field.

 




No comments:

Post a Comment

EMBRACING CHANGE IN EDUCATION

The teaching profession has always been a cornerstone of societal progress, shaping young minds and fostering innovation. However, as we mov...